Section 40-24-104 - Attorney's Fees

40-24-104. Attorney's fees. (a) A court may award reasonable attorney's fees to the prevailing party if: (i) A claim of misappropriation is made in bad faith; (ii) A motion to terminate an injunction is made or resisted in bad faith; or (iii) Willful and malicious misappropriation exists.
